NetApp Acquires Fylamynt to Bring Automation Capabilities to Spot by NetApp’s Leading CloudOps Portfolio
February 23, 2022 4:15 PM ESTSAN JOSE, Calif.--(BUSINESS WIRE)-- NetApp (NASDAQ: NTAP), a global, cloud-led, data-centric software company, today announced that it has acquired Fylamynt, a venture-backed, innovative CloudOps automation technology company that enables customers to build, run, manage and analyze workflows securely in any cloud with little to no code. Financial details of the transaction are not being disclosed.

NetApp Reports Third Quarter of Fiscal Year 2022 Results
February 23, 2022 4:01 PM ESTNet revenues for the third quarter grew 10% year-over-year to $1.61 billionÂ
NetApp Public Cloud annualized revenue run rate (ARR)1 increased 98% year-over-year to $469 million All-flash array annualized net revenue run rate2 reached an all-time high of $3.2 billion Product revenue grew 9% year-over-year to $846 million, the fourth consecutive quarter of year-over-year growth Billings3 were $1.76 billion, an increase of 10% year-over-year Increased full fiscal year 2022 revenue and EPS guidance $236 million returned to shareholders in share repurchases and cash dividendsSAN JOSE, Calif.--(BUSINESS WIRE)-- NetApp (NASDAQ:...
